"NFL | D. Jackson measures in at NFL Combine
Fri, 22 Feb 2008 09:00:29 -0800
During his press conference at the NFL Scouting Combine Friday, Feb. 22, California WR DeSean Jackson said he measured 5-foot-9 and weighed in at 169 pounds."
